Fort Riley is one of the Army's largest installations and home of the 1st Infantry Division. Military families here face distinct credit challenges: PCS move-related misreporting, SCRA protections that creditors sometimes fail to apply, security clearance considerations, and VA loan preparation. White Jacobs can review military credit files for FCRA inaccuracies and SCRA compliance issues. Results cannot be guaranteed, but an accurate file is the appropriate foundation.
VA loans are widely used in Manhattan given Fort Riley's size. VA loans require no down payment, no PMI, and offer competitive rates for eligible veterans, active-duty members, and surviving spouses. Most lenders require 620+ for approval, though the VA itself has no minimum. Inaccurate accounts from PCS moves can unnecessarily block VA loan access. White Jacobs can review a veteran's file and prepare disputes before application.
The Servicemembers Civil Relief Act provides significant protections including interest rate caps on pre-service debt, protections against default judgments, and in some cases protections against repossession and foreclosure. If a creditor failed to apply SCRA protections and reported an account incorrectly as a result, that may be disputable under both SCRA and FCRA. Kansas State University students and graduates face credit challenges common to young adults: thin files, student loan reporting issues, and first credit card accounts. Grace period violations — student loans reported late during an active post-graduation grace period — are a common and disputable error. Manhattan's mortgage market is shaped by both Fort Riley and K-State. VA loans are common for military buyers and require no down payment. For university employees and graduates, FHA and conventional loans are the primary path. FHA accommodates scores from 580; conventional requires 620+.
